3. What the ad tag collects

When our tag requests a decision for a visitor to your site, we process the following for that request:

  • Approximate country, device type, operating system and browser
  • The referring domain, to confirm the request came from your verified site
  • A one-way hash of the IP address and user agent, used only to enforce the frequency cap so the same visitor isn't shown a second pop inside the capped window
  • Signals used to identify automated traffic, including the network a request originates from
  • A random click identifier, used to connect an impression to a conversion

Raw IP addresses are not stored. The hashes cannot be reversed to recover an address and are not used to identify or track individuals across sites. Event-level records are kept for up to 90 days for billing and dispute resolution; after that only aggregated daily totals remain.

4. Cookies

This website sets no cookies and runs no analytics or third-party scripts. The ad tag does not rely on cookies for frequency capping.
